Tangerine belongs to Citrus category whereas Cantaloupe belongs to Melon category. Tangerine originated in South-Eastern Asia while Cantaloupe originated in Africa and India.

Tangerine and Cantaloupe Varieties

Tangerine and Cantaloupe varieties form an important part of Tangerine vs Cantaloupe characteristics. Due to advancements and development in the field of horticulture science, it is possible to get many varieties of Tangerine and Cantaloupe. The varieties of Tangerine are Clementine, Dancy, King Mandarin, Murcott, Ponkan, Robinson, Satsuma and Sunburst whereas the varieties of Cantaloupe are Hales Best Jumbo, Sweet 'N Early Hybrid, Hearts of Gold, Ambrosia, Athena, Honey Bun Hybrid, Fastbreak and Superstar. The shape of Tangerine and Cantaloupe is Round and Round respecitely. Talking about the taste, Tangerine is sweet-sour in taste and Cantaloupe is juicy, musky and sweet.
